Posted on 17 Pebruari 2010. Tags: akademik, rilis, sistem informasi sekolah, Sistem Informasi Sekolah Terpadu
Pada rilis ini, format laporan mid semester diubah, seperti pada posting yg lalu, Tetapi untuk
sementara hanya format pdf yg didukung.
Saya harus melakukan sedikit re-search, bagaimana membuat class yang bisa men-transformasi
input untuk jqgrid sehingga bisa digunakan sebagai pdf output, excel ouput dan grafik output.
Berikut ini adalah format PDF hasil generate OpenThink SAS. Jika di cetak sekaligus
1 kelas ukuran file nya mencapai 800 kb, di laptop saya ini membutuhkan waktu > 80 detik
prosesnya, sedangkan default waktu eksekusi skrip php secara default ada;ah 30 detik,
mudah-mudahan hosting server membolehkan kita mengubah limitasi ini di php.ini server
mereka. Read the full story
Posted in Sistem Informasi Sekolah
Posted on 06 Pebruari 2010. Tags: rilis, sistem informasi akademik, sistem informasi sekolah, Sistem Informasi Sekolah Terpadu
- Timestamp:
- 02/06/10 13:32:
- Author:
- wildan
- Message:
- tahun ajar dapat diubah tanpa logout, export excel siswa per kelas sesuai standar, dll.
Ini request berdasarkan post forum : http://sas.openthinklabs.com/forum/permintaan-fitur-baru/permintaan-dari-pak-adang/
- Location:
- branches/openthinksas-alpha-sf10
- Files:
-
- apps/openthinksas/config/view.yml (modified) (1 diff)
- apps/openthinksas/modules/academic/actions/KenaikanKelasAction.class.php (modified) (2 diffs)
- apps/openthinksas/modules/academic/templates/ListNilaiAfektifSuccess.php (modified) (1 diff)
- apps/openthinksas/modules/academic/templates/ListNilaiHarianSuccess.php (modified) (1 diff)
- apps/openthinksas/modules/academic/templates/ListNilaiPraktikSuccess.php (modified) (1 diff)
- apps/openthinksas/modules/academic/templates/_rapor_walikelas.php (modified) (3 diffs)
- apps/openthinksas/modules/report/actions/ListSiswaPerKelasExcelAction.class.php (added)
- apps/openthinksas/modules/sekolah/actions/ListSiswaPerKelasAction.class.php (added)
- apps/openthinksas/modules/sekolah/actions/actions.class.php (modified) (4 diffs)
- apps/openthinksas/modules/sekolah/templates/ListSiswaPerKelasSuccess.php (modified) (1 diff)
- apps/openthinksas/modules/user/actions/ubahTahunAjaranAction.class.php (added)
- apps/openthinksas/templates/layout.php (modified) (2 diffs)
- lib/helper/SIMMSITHelper.php (modified) (1 diff)
- lib/model/SiswaKelas.php (modified) (1 diff)
- web/js/openthinksas.js
Posted in Sistem Informasi Sekolah
Posted on 13 November 2009. Tags: sistem informasi sekolah, Sistem Informasi Sekolah Terpadu


Meneruskan pengembangan minggu lalu, memanfaatkan waktu-waktu sela di malam hari, saya masih memfokuskan diri untuk mengoptimalkan penggunan jqgrid, agar penggunaan aplikasi ini menjadi lebih mudah dan cepat responenya.
Pada tabel detail nilai rapor bayangan seorang siswa terpilih yang disebelah kanan, Anda lihat dibagian atasnya ada dua buah icon, icon pdf dan grafik. Icon pdf ini untuk mencetak rapor bayangan siswa yg terpilih ini ke format pdf dan icon grafik untuk melihat visualisasi nilai siswa ini (Catatan : untuk saat ini grafik nya masih belum selesai, hanya prototipe saja seperti anda lihat pada gambar berikutnya). Sedangkan jika ingin mencetak rapor bayangan seluruh siswa diseluruh kelas, anda bisa mengklik icon pdf pada form bagian atas.
Lho kok grafiknya pie ?
, seperti saya bilang tadi ini hanya prototipe saja, nantinya tentu yang digunakan adalah
bar group. Grafik ini nanti bisa di resize/ubah ukurannya dan disimpan dalam format png. Watermark nya dapat diganti
dengan lgoo sekolah ataupun logo perusahaan yang memberikan donasi ke sekolah yang bersangkutan.
Saya masih mempelajari buku statistik pendidikan yang kelihatannya menarik, nantinya akan ada semacam Sistem Informasi Eksekutif yang akan memberikan informasi yang intuitive kepada stakeholder di sekolah yang bersangkutan, Sistem Informasi Eksekutif ini, berbasis OpenThink Dashboard http://en.wordpress.com/tag/openthink-dashboard/.
Manajemen usernya pun saya ubah menggunakan jqGrid untuk mempercepat navigasi data. Tampilan diatas masih jauh
dari sempurna
. Tapi minimal fungsionalitas yg lama (non web 2.0) sudah tergantikan …
Sekian laporan minggu ini …
Development highlights
11/13/09:
- 15:44 Changeset [31] by wildan
- penyempurnaan laporan rapor bayangan dan user management di backend dan …
11/10/09:
- 23:52 Changeset [30] by wildan
- menu backend menggunakan YUI, UserManagement? di backend sedang dalam …
- 22:44 Changeset [29] by wildan
- dibuat prototype chart untuk rapor bayangan per siswa
- 22:42 Changeset [28] by wildan
- add svn external for OFC lib
- 00:05 Changeset [27] by wildan
- Penyempurnaan Laporan Rapor Bayangan Siswa, skrg bisa print pdf persiswa …
Posted in Sistem Informasi Sekolah
Posted on 06 November 2009. Tags: rilis, sistem informasi sekolah, Sistem Informasi Sekolah Terpadu
Pada minggu ini (memanfaatkan waktu-waktu luang di malam hari ^_^ ) beberapa bugs kecil telah diperbaiki
dan tadi malam laporan rapor bayangan baru saya ubah agar selain report PDF terdapat juga HTML view nya yang diputuskan menggunakan grid dan master detail view untuk UI-nya. Screenshoot yang anda lihat diatas masih belum selesai, jadi harap maklum ^_^. Penjelasan detail tentang fungsionalitas Rapor Bayangan ini akan saya jelaskan di posting berikutnya.
Perlu diketahui, OpenThink SAS yang skrg masih berada di branches dengan status alpha dan masih menggunakan symfony 1.0. Saya sudah mulai membuat OpenThink SAS 1.0 di trunk yang akan ditulis ulang menggukan symfony 1.3 dan Doctrine sebagai ORMnya. Mengapa Doctrine ? dan mengapa symfony 1.3 ? Ini dikarenakan seri symfony 1.x berikutnya adalah 1.4 yang merupakan rilis terakhir 1.x dan Sensio Labs menyatakan kalau symfony 1.4 ini memiliki Long Time Support (LTS) selama 3 tahun. Selain itu Doctrine dipilih, karena ini adalah ORM termatang di PHP, untuk diketahui saja, Zend Framework akan menggunakan Doctrine sebagai komponen ORM nya. Selain itu, core developer dari Propel sendiri sudah pergi .., karena di memutuskan untuk menggunakan python sebagai bahasa pengembangan utama
.
Python memang bahasa yang menarik, jika anda baru pertama kali ingin belajar bahasa pemrograman, sangat disarankan menggunakan bahasa ini. MIT pun menggunakan bahasa ini pada tahun pertamanya nya.
Roadmap pengembangan lengkap OpenThink SAS akan dibuat minggu depan.
Development highlights
11/05/09: Yesterday
- 18:07 Changeset [26] by wildan
- add new plugin
- 17:48 Changeset [25] by wildan
- fix formatter cell
- 14:22 Changeset [24] by wildan
- add dtXmlReporter plugin
- 14:04 Changeset [23] by wildan
11/04/09:
- 01:40 Changeset [22] by wildan
- 01:38 Changeset [21] by wildan
- fix bug di rumus nilai rapor
- 01:31 Changeset [20] by wildan
- update form nilai harian, tapi cell color < skbm belum
- 00:04 Changeset [19] by wildan
- variabel $pelajaranKelas tidak digunakan
11/03/09:
- 00:43 Ticket #3 (Schema Siswa Mutasi) created by wildan.m
tabel siswa_mutasi referensi nya harus dibuah ke kd_unit_kerja
Posted in Sistem Informasi Sekolah
Posted on 17 Oktober 2009. Tags: sistem informasi sekolah, Sistem Informasi Sekolah Terpadu
Pembagian rapor bayangan di SMPIT Nurul Fikri telah berjalan dengan baik, alhamdulillah kehadiran OpenThink SAS (OpenThink School Automation System) mempermudah proses evaluasi pendidikan.
Tak terasa sudah 1,5 tahun berjalan, yang akan dioptimalkan kedepan adalah
penelitian di bidang statistik pendidikan dan penelitian tindakan kelas berbasis data statistik ini. Untuk tahun depan OpenThink Dashboard akan dijadikan plugin dan diintegrasikan dengan OpenThink SAS (OpenThink School Automation System) untuk menangani visualisasi data & laporan kustom.
Untuk November 2009, berdasarkan evaluasi dan permintaan pengguna akhir, penambahan & pengerjaan fitur-fitur berikut akan didahulukan :
- Proses tambah/edit/hapus KKM/SKBM dapat dilakukan per-tingkat
- Form pendaftaran siswa akan dioptimalisasi dengan menggunakan Ajax sehingga user experience akan meningkat
- PSS (Parenf Self Service) akan diaktifkan
- Nilai di rapor bayangan akan ditambahkan pilihan untuk
menentukan bobot-bobot masing-masing komponen nilai
- Form entri nilai akan menggunakan jqGrid (http://www.trirand.com/blog/)
Posted in Sistem Informasi Sekolah
Recent Comments